Wireless Mesh Network(WMN), is a type of network which links routers and terminal equipments with wireless multi-hop links. It is a new broad bandwidth distributing wireless access network system, and is a wireless version of the Internet as a static wireless network. It can be considered as a integration of WLAN and MANET. WMN has features of reliability,self-organization and self-healing. Comparing with the traditional wired,wireless network,WMN has unparalleled advantages and is more convenient and low-cost.WMNs have a wide range of potential applications for the Wireless Personal Area Network,LAN,even MAN,providing wireless broadband access service. Currently, research of WMN is very active all across the world, and gradually developed into commercial and civilian application stage. In the meantime, the relevant international standards about WMN is being developed. In Chapter 2 of this article, more details of WMN will be given.Routing protocol is one of the key technologies in WMN which will play a very important role in its network performance. WMN is a special form of MANET, it inherited many of the characteristics of MANET. Traditional routing protocols of MANET are still usable in WMNs, but it is better to consider their uniqueness. For this reason, the design principle,ideas and trends of WMN routing protocols were analysed and lucubrated in this paper. After a general introduction of two types of routing protocols(Table Driven,On Demand-driven) for MANET, three typical MANET routing protocols(DSDV,AODV,DSR) were used in WMN. They were simulated by NS2 which is a popular network simulation tool,and their performance were analysed. Then, based on the characteristics of WMN , a Protocol-based DSR Multi-gateway Anycast Multi-path Source Routing Protocol MAMSR was designed and simulated in NS2. The simulation results show it can solve the congestion problem effectively in single gateway and keep the access network working effectively and stably under high Packet Mailing Rate,low Average Routing Overhead and Average Delay.
